Away from the octagon since the tough defeat suffered by Francis Ngannou, in March 2021, which cost him the heavyweight title (up to 120,2kg.) in the UFC, Stipe Miocic resurfaced and presented a little of his other profession. A member of the Cuyahoga County Fire Department (USA), the fighter released images of fire containment training. The athlete spoke about the experience on social media.

“I had fun yesterday with the department. I had an active fire as training. It's always fun to do this, especially with other departments in neighboring cities. I learned, played and the best part was the food at the end. The cleaning part wasn’t so great, especially because the weather wasn’t on our side”, wrote the fighter, in his account on Instagram.
The North American, who divides his activities between firefighter and Ultimate fighter, hasn't stepped into the Octagon for almost a year. In his last appearance, Miocic ended up losing his position as Ultimate champion in a hard way, when he was brutalized by Ngannou.
At 39 years old and considered one of the best heavyweights of all time, Stipe has already assured that he is not thinking about retirement. The fighter, however, remains without an opponent for his return to MMA.
A professional in mixed martial arts since 2010, Miocic has had 24 clashes in the sport. Today, the fighter has 20 triumphs and four setbacks.
